Lightweight Bricks, Red Bricks, SWOTAbstract
Walls are a crucial element in construction projects, serving as roof supports, room partitions, and weather barriers. Traditional materials commonly used are red bricks, made from molded and fired clay, with standard dimensions of 20 cm x 11 cm x 5 cm. While red bricks are considered robust and readily accessible, they weigh up to 250 kg/m², which can increase the structural load and material costs due to greater adhesive requirements. This study employs interviews and questionnaires to gather data from users, workers, and material suppliers as a basis for analysis. The data collected consists of two types: primary data obtained directly through field surveys, including interviews and questionnaires, and secondary data sourced from other references, such as the AHSP DPUTR in the case study area of Banjar City. The analysis reveals that lightweight bricks, made from a mixture of cement, lime, and expanding agents, offer advantages in strength and market potential. Lightweight bricks have dimensions of 20 cm x 60 cm x 8-10 cm and weigh only 57.5 kg/m², making them 4.34 times lighter than red bricks. Despite the efficiency of lightweight bricks, the unit price in Banjar City remains higher, at Rp 125,000.00/m² compared to Rp 117,062.55/m² for red bricks. This research provides valuable insights for the community in selecting wall materials, considering specific needs and the existing construction context
